Re: Baylor TurnaroundGo to any certified AAU event in Texas where college coaches are allowed to show up and there is at least one good prospect that baylor would want. You will always see a Baylor coach there. And I do mean every single time. Period. Baylor coaches will attend even the smallest events.
Recruits always notice which college coaches are showing up to see them play. They also notice which coaches are NOT in attendance. There are a lot of AAU events in Dallas all summer long. How do you think it affects SMU's chances with a prospect when he is playing in Dallas and a Baylor coach makes the effort to drive up from Waco to watch him but nobody from SMU will make the effort to drive 10 or 15 minutes to represent? Doherty and the SMU coaches will show up at the bigger events and they also attend some of the medium sized events. But they do not work everything. They do not work their asses off at recruiting Texas high school talent. How many high school players signed by Scott Drew ever received serious attention SMU? Not many.
